10:00-4:00PM Little Boy then Wabedo
Conditions: 80-67℉, Cloudy to Sunny, Calm to mild NW Wind, water level appears to be down.  I think the water temps were in the high 60's with an algae bloom happening on Little Boy.

I arrived just after Alan had bugged out of the access area, oops.  As we were heading out he asked me who I was paired up with for the tournament.  I informed him that he was my boater.  Apparently when I left my message for him the night before I didn't make that clear.  He thought I had found out he was going to be fishing the lakes this day and just wanted to tag along.

We started in Little Boy on a weedline spot.  Didn't get anything there, but there seemed to be activity in the near by super tall and thick reeds.  We then headed to the inlet on the North end.  I had a 36 or so inch muskie follow my Whopper Plopper.  Alan got a quality bass right away in the reeds.  I got a 2lber on a yellow Terminator Frog.  Alan got a couple more bass and I had a couple of blow ups that didn't get the frog.  We then moved to a large reed bed on the West side of the lake.  We picked up some small bass there.  I also lost a good bass that hung me in the reeds and also had what I am assuming was a big muskie do the same.

We then moved farther South and Alan got a couple of more good fish in the reeds.  I had a good sized pike strike the Terminator and got bit off by another one.  Alan eagle eyed where it was on the bottom of the lake, so I got it back.

We then moved on to Wabedo.  Didn't get anything there until we got to the far southern end of the lake.  I got a couple bass out of the pads on the Terminator.  We headed back up close to the channel to LB and I got some pike and my last bass of the day out of the reeds.  We stopped at one more spot on Wabedo, didn't get anything and left.
